In 2004, NBC attained a broadcast agreement With all the National Hockey League (NHL). The income-sharing deal known as for the two sides to separate advertising earnings after NBC recouped the fees. Game titles were being speculated to start off airing on NBC in the 2004??5 year, on the other hand a league lockout that resulted while in the cancellation of that period delayed the start of the deal right until the next fifty percent from the 2005??6 NHL season. NBC televised frequent year video games initially on Saturday afternoons before going the telecast to Sundays, Saturday and Sunday afternoon playoff online games, and up to five games with the Stanley Cup.

National and native media each provide main roles in broadcasting sports in America. Dependant upon the league and occasion, telecasts will often be proven live on network tv (typically on weekends And through main situations ??both countrywide through a tv network, or sometimes, regionally syndicated by an Procedure including Raycom Sports or simply a group), and nationally out there cable channels (like ESPN or Fox Sports one).
